Classic Grilled Mac and Cheese on the Arteflame Grill

Classic Grilled Mac and Cheese

Introduction

Indulge in the rich, comforting flavors of classic mac and cheese with a smoky twist by grilling it on the Arteflame. This recipe combines creamy cheese sauce with perfectly cooked macaroni, then grills it to add a delicious smoky flavor.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ups elbow macaroni
  • 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 cups milk
  • 1/4 cup butter
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ika

Instructions

  1. Preheat your Arteflame grill to get it ready.
  2. Cook the elbow macaroni according to package instructions in a pan on the Arteflame cooktop. Drain and set aside.
  3. In a saucepan, melt the butter on the flat griddle cooktop. Stir in the flour and cook for 1-2 minutes until bubbly.
  4. Gradually whisk in the milk, continuing to stir until the mixture thickens.
  5. Add the cheddar, mozzarella, and Parmesan cheeses, stirring until melted and smooth.
  6. Season with salt, pepper, and smoked paprika.
  7. Spread the cooked macaroni onto the flat griddle cooktop and grill until it has a nice crunchy outside. Stir regularly.
  8. Combine the cooked macaroni with the cheese sauce in a skillet, mixing well.
  9. Place the skillet on the grill and cook until the top is bubbly and golden brown.
  10. Remove from the grill and let it cool slightly before serving.

Tips

  • For extra flavor, sprinkle breadcrumbs on top before grilling.
  • Add cooked bacon or ham for a delicious twist.
  • Serve with a side of grilled vegetables for a complete meal.

BBQ Pulled Pork Grilled Mac and Cheese

BBQ Pulled Pork Grilled Mac and Cheese

Introduction

Combine the rich flavors of BBQ pulled pork with creamy mac and cheese, grilled to perfection on the Arteflame. This recipe creates a hearty, smoky dish that's perfect for any occasion.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ups elbow macaroni
  • 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 cups milk
  • 1/4 cup butter
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 cups pulled pork, cooked
  • 1 cup BBQ sauce
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at your Arteflame grill to get it ready.
  2. Cook the elbow macaroni according to package instructions in a large pan on the flat griddle cooktop. Drain and set aside.
  3. In a sa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Stir in the flour and cook for 1-2 minutes until bubbly.
  4. Gradually whisk in the milk, continuing to stir until the mixture thickens.
  5. Add the cheddar, mozzarella, and Parmesan cheeses, stirring until melted and smooth.
  6. Season with salt and pepper.
  7. Place the pulled pork directly on the flat griddle cooktop and give it a nice sear.
  8. Spread the cooked macaroni onto the flat griddle cooktop and grill until it has a nice crunchy outside. Stir regularly.
  9. Combine the cooked macaroni with the cheese sauce, mixing well.
  10. Transfer the mac and cheese to a cast-iron skillet or grill-safe pan.
  11. Top with the pulled pork and drizzle with BBQ sauce.
  12. Place the skillet on the grill and cook until the top is bubbly and golden brown.
  13. Remove from the grill and let it cool slightly before serving.

Tips

  • For extra flavor, add sliced jalapenos or caramelized onions.
  • Use smoked cheddar for a deeper smoky taste.
  • Serve with a side of coleslaw for a complete meal.
